## Runbook: Pricing Experiment

The Farelight ticket-pricing experiment toggles via the Splitwren flag service. To pause the experiment, set variant weights to zero and flush the pricing cache. Cache flush requires authenticating against the internal Splitwren admin endpoint. Use the key below for that call.

gateway credential: kto23_LX9A4ys6i4nzHtpOLNLodKK

The rendering team confirmed a font-metrics regression introduced in the morning deploy affecting multi-page invoices only. Affected customers could still download correct CSV copies as a workaround. The deploy was rolled back at 10:12, and regenerated invoices were queued automatically. For any customer escalations about documents produced in that window, reference the faulty renderer build noted below.

build token for tawip-yageg: htk9_92ac43d42

# Build Provenance: InkMill Rendering Pipeline

Welcome aboard. Every InkMill markdown build is produced by the hermetic renderer, and each artifact carries a provenance record tying it to the exact source commit, theme bundle, and toolchain image. Never deploy a render output that lacks this record — the gateway will reject it anyway. To verify an artifact locally, run the provenance checker and compare against the token printed below.

trace token, fafof-tajef: htk9_849b0fd88

## v2.8.0 — Changed defaults

The Snapfern thumbnail queue now defaults to signed payloads and rejects unauthenticated enqueue requests. Worker concurrency dropped from 16 to 8 to limit blast radius during image-parser exploits, and EXIF stripping is enabled by default. Temp files are written to a per-job directory with 0700 permissions and purged on completion. The active defaults for this release are listed below.

service settings:
HOLDOR_PIN=6477
HOLDOR_METRICS_HOST=metrics.holdor.nelvrocorp.corp
HOLDOR_LOG_LEVEL=error
HOLDOR_TENANT=noviel